Little India brings the vibrant flavors of India to Gilroy, United States. With a 4.3-star rating based on 387 reviews, we're dedicated to providing a delicious and convenient dining experience. Enjoy our diverse menu through dine-in, takeout, or delivery. We offer fast service for lunch and dinner, along with a great selection of teas. We are committed to accessibility, featuring a wheelchair accessible entrance, parking lot, restroom, and seating. Please note we are closed on Mondays, but open Tuesday through Sunday from 11 AM to 9 PM. We welcome solo diners and groups alike!

Ula Z

Little India is one of those places that seems a little inconspicuous - it sits in a corner, and is rarely full however, it should be! We have been here a few times - by ourselves, with a small group and for take out, and each time the experience and food has been great. The service has always been friendly, casual and attentive, occasionally overly so, but I do prefer extra refills on my homemade chai to an empty cup. Food is always quick, but that could be due to the fact that there is rarely more that one or two other tables occupied. The food. Again, I cannot believe it isn't busier! Often, Indian dishes all start to taste exactly the same in western restaurants, so it is a real pleasure to order an array and be able to distinguish the delicate flavours and the spice levels between them. There is a great vegetarian selection which I cannot wait to try more of, and goat is on the menu! Yes!! Yum! There is always a great balance of meat and sauce in the dishes and the Naan is not too thick. I usually have trouble stopping once I start here. They also offer tandoori wraps which we have had once before. Excellent. All in all, I label this one of my favourite comfort food places, for either take out, of to just sit and eat, even it if is a little expensive.
